Choller

/ˈtʃɒlə/ noun

Definition

A cholla cactus, or a person who gathers or works with chollas.

Etymology

Direct borrowing from Spanish 'chollero,' derived from 'cholla.' This term was used historically by people in the Southwest who worked with or harvested these plants.

Kelly Says

In the 1800s, chollers would sometimes harvest cholla buds as a food source—they're actually quite nutritious and are still eaten in Mexico and by Native American tribes today!
